One popular method for obtaining this delightful color is marinating the eggs in beet juice. When hard-boiled eggs are submerged in a blend of vinegar, spices, and beet juice, the surface of the whites gradually absorbs the crimson dye, producing a bright pink shell and a pleasantly tart flavor. This coloring process differs by duration, typically ranging from a few hours for a faint hue to several days for a deeper coloration. Apart from their eye-catching appearance, beet-infused eggs feature a one-of-a-kind bite that makes them different from standard hard-boiled eggs.
